We left the vet tonight with an actual glucose reading. Still little high, but she came in at 390. They said when this all started that she started way over 600 (it wouldn't even read on their machine), then dropped to over 500 (still little off their machine readings), then 460 and now 390. They want us to up her insulin dosage another 2 cc's so that will put her at 15 cc's twice a day. I know that part she hates and they says she'll get use to it, but they don't know my Stormy girl...lol Rob snuck up on her this morning at shot time...lol She didn't even know what hit her :)
The good news for mom's pocketbook is that we can do a weekly visit instead of twice a week! WOO-HOO!! That's a sign to me that we are on our way to the lower numbers and I know it was from all the good vibes! They said a normal dog that isn't diabetic runs around 100-120 and a dog that is diabetic runs around 150-200 so we are getting there. :) I was really surprised at all this informatin they all of a sudden offered, but I'm sure glad, maybe I can relax a little bit now :) love the power of prayers!!
